I am using UJA 1076 and I put it to sleep mode. So I need wake-up sequence remotely.

According to the application note attached below, how should the wake-up message be?

What should the message ID of the CAN message be?

Should the time between frames be 0.5 - 3 us?

Is the message to be sent [0x01,0x00.0x01,0x00] without message ID?

the whole wake-up recessive-dominant-recessive-dominant sequence occurred on the CAN bus must be shorter, than the tto(wake) time. 

Screenshot_2.png

At the same time, the recessive and dominant times must be minimally twake(busrec)min and twake(busdom)min respectively. 

JozefKozon_0-1688716818790.png

Its best if you take the tto(wake) minimum value, 400us and the twake(busrec)min and twake(busdom)min maximum values. For both 3us. Even in this case you have plenty of time to conduct the wake-up recessive-dominant-recessive-dominant sequence within the tto(wake)=400us. 4*3us=12us.

Screenshot_3.png

The times between the recessive and dominant pulses is not stated.

you can disable the Bus wake-up detection with setting the STBCC bit to 0. If the STBCC is set to one, the recessive-dominant-recessive-dominant sequence will wake up the UJA1076. Yes, no message ID is required. 

When the UJA1076 woke-up with a random CAN message, can you please check if the message didn't contain the recessive-dominant-recessive-dominant sequence?

The wake-up pattern doesn't need to contain the CAN ID, DATA, nor CRC value. Any pattern on the CANH and CANL pins will wake-up the SBC as long as it fulfills the CAN wake-up timing diagram in the Figure 9.
